Zoria is a slab serif typeface. Unlike traditional serifs (like Times New Roman) which have delicate transitions, Zoria features block-like serifs (the "feet" of the letters) that are roughly the same thickness as the strokes. The weight is the heavy lifter of the family, designed to grab attention without feeling aggressive.
